Pokusit se o napsání hry snake, kde snake sám dohraje hru (to znamená zaplní celý prostor hracího pole). Snake se bude snažit najít optimální cestu k jablku a přitom se nezabít. Pomocí různých algoritmů se budu pokoušet o to aby snake dokázal najít jablko co nejoptimálněji a takto co nejlépe dohrál hru. V práci se budu snažit využít pomoc např. těchto algoritmů A* algoritmus (algoritmus najde nejkratší z bodu A do bodu B) a algoritmy na hledání Hamiltonovské kružnice (najde takovou cestu v grafu, která navštíví každý vrchol právě jednou a vrátí se na počáteční vrchol). Soucasti prace bude porovnani techto ruznzch algoritmu.
-
Notifications
You must be signed in to change notification settings - Fork 0
gyarab/2024-4e-merkulov-SnakeAI
Folders and files
Name | Name | Last commit message | Last commit date | |
---|---|---|---|---|
Repository files navigation
About
No description, website, or topics provided.
Resources
Stars
Watchers
Forks
Releases
No releases published
Packages 0
No packages published